Freehold semi-detached house at Lilac Road on the block for $3.98 mil
By Timothy Tay | April 1, 2021

SINGAPORE (EDGEPROP) - The owner of a freehold semi-detached house at Lilac Road, off Nim Road in District 28, is selling the property for $3.98 million. The house will be offered at Edmund Tie’s upcoming auction on April 28 and it will be the first time the property will be sold through an auction.

The two-storey property features a car porch that can fit two cars and the ground floor of the house includes a guest bedroom, a living area, and a dining room that extends onto the rear porch. The second floor comprises a master bedroom with ensuite bathroom, two bedrooms, and a common bathroom.

The property for sale is in a three-storey mixed landed housing estate within Seletar Hills which comprises low density landed housing estates. The area’s connectivity is primarily served by the Central Expressway and major roads such as Ang Mo Kio Avenue 5 and Yio Chu Kang Road.



Nearby amenities include Seletar Mall, Greenwich V, and Ang Mo Kio Hub. The house is also within 2km of Rosyth School, Jing Shan Primary School, Fernvale Primary School, and Sengkang Green Primary School. Nearby educational institutes include Anderson Serangoon Junior College, Nanyang Polytechnic and ITE College Central.

The semi-detached house sits on a land area of 4,173 sq ft and the guide price translates to $954 psf on the land area. The house has a built-up area of approximately 2,800 sq ft.

According to Joy Tan, head of auction & sales at Edmund Tie, the current guide price based on the land area is “very reasonable” given recent transactions in the area. “Recent resale transactions in the area show that most properties have changed hands for more than $1,100 psf,” says Tan.

Based on URA caveats, a freehold terrace house at 11 Lilac Drive was sold for $2.4 million ($1,117 psf) on Nov 6, 2020, while another freehold terrace house at 4 Lilac Walk was sold for $2.5 million ($1,151 psf) on Sept 11, 2020.

Nearby, a 999-year leasehold semi-detached house at 16A Nim Drive was sold for $4.1 million ($1,726 psf) on July 13, 2020, and the neighbouring semi-detached house at 16 Nim Drive fetched $4.05 million ($1,706 psf) on March 26, 2020.

“The freehold tenure of the house at Lilac Road makes it an attractive proposition for landed home buyers who are keen to acquire a freehold asset. The subject property is also primed for redevelopment into a 3½-storey property, and it sits on a sizeable land area of 4,731 sq ft with a wide street frontage of about 13m,” says Tan, adding that the house also features a generous outdoor area with a good-sized garden and a spacious porch area suitable for outdoor entertaining.

Given these attributes, Tan expects the property to appeal to homeowners looking for a freehold home for their family, or boutique developers with a keen eye for properties with redevelopment potential.
